industry | Business Traveller Africa | Page 5
Tags Industry

Tag: industry

Industry Comment

Industry Comment

Industry Comment

Industry Comment

Industry Comment

Industry Comment

Industry Comment

Industry Comment

Industry Comment

Industry Commment

Industry Comment

Industry Comment